Zenprint is the Australian arm of the Gogoprint Group, bringing Southeast Asia's online printing model to Australia. Launched in 2019 with AUD 10.7M Series A backing, it uses AI to aggregate orders for cost efficiency and targets Australian SMEs with transparent pricing.
Zenprint/Gogoprint maintains operations across Thailand, Australia, Singapore, Malaysia, and Indonesia; uses AI-powered order aggregation algorithms to match customers with local print partners for cost-efficient fulfillment
Cloudflare case study / Gogoprint websiteGogoprint Group (parent of Zenprint) continues content marketing and operational activities across APAC markets; employee count reportedly decreased from ~130 to ~45-51 staff across the group, suggesting operational restructuring

Canon PRISMA Workflow Solutions
Canon PRISMA Software Solutions are production print applications from Canon Production Printing. PRISMAdirect is a web-based workflow management solution with optional Webshop Module for web to print submission. PRISMAsync Mark 8 was announced as the first DFE-embedded Idealliance G7 Certified System.

Canva
Canva is an Australian graphic design platform founded in 2013 by Melanie Perkins, Cliff Obrecht, and Cameron Adams. Headquartered in Sydney, Canva offers a full design suite with integrated print services (Canva Print), strong APIs, and AI-powered tools. With 260 million monthly active users (end 2025), 27 million paid seats, and $3.3B ARR (August 2025), Canva is the world's largest design platform. Valued at $42-65B through 2025 secondary sales. Profitable for eight consecutive years. In October 2025, Canva launched its Creative Operating System featuring the Canva Design Model (world's first design-aware AI). Key acquisitions include Affinity ($380M, March 2024), Leonardo AI (August 2024), and MagicBrief (June 2025). IPO expected in H2 2026, likely in the US. Total funding raised: $589M. Hired former Zoom CFO Kelly Steckelberg in late 2024 ahead of IPO preparations.

CloudLab Sales & Management GmbH
CloudLab is a Dortmund-based B2B web to print software company providing the technology behind some of Europe's largest online printers. Its flagship printQ platform (Magento-based) powers W2P storefronts for clients including Flyeralarm and Cimpress. The company also offers packQ (EDP Award-winning digital packaging design) and brandQ (brand management portals).
